Cycle complexity
Cyclomatic complexity is a software metric used to indicate the complexity of a program. It is a quantitative measure of the number of linearly independent paths through a program's source code. It was developed by Thomas J. McCabe, Sr. in 1976. Cyclomatic complexity is computed using the control-flow graph … See more Definition The cyclomatic complexity of a section of source code is the number of linearly independent paths within it—a set of paths being linearly dependent if there is a subset of one or … See more Limiting complexity during development One of McCabe's original applications was to limit the complexity of routines during program development; he recommended that programmers should count the complexity of the modules they are developing, and … See more • Programming complexity • Complexity trap • Computer program • Computer programming • Control flow See more Cyclomatic complexity may also be used for the evaluation of the semantic complexity of artificial intelligence programs. See more Cyclomatic complexity has proven useful in geographical and landscape-ecological analysis, after it was shown that it can be implemented on graphs of ultrametric distances. See more • Generating cyclomatic complexity metrics with Polyspace • The role of empiricism in improving the reliability of future software • McCabe's Cyclomatic Complexity and Why We Don't Use It See more WebNov 7, 2024 · Time complexity is defined as the amount of time taken by an algorithm to run, as a function of the length of the input. It measures the time taken to execute each statement of code in an algorithm. It is not going to examine the total execution time of an algorithm. Rather, it is going to give information about the variation (increase or ...
Cycle complexity
Did you know?
Webcode-complexity-review; code-complexity-review v0.0.1. check code cycle complexity For more information about how to use this package see README. Latest version published 2 years ago. License: ISC. NPM. WebIf life cycle complexity is adaptive, it should be evolutionarily labile, that is, change in response to selection. We provide evidence that this is true in some aphids (aphidines), …
WebThe program focuses on employee wellbeing in four areas: security and safety, psychosocial support, organisational policies, working conditions and environment. To support this work, I rely on my 15+ years of experience in the humanitarian and development arena as a Human Resources professional, thus I understand the complexity of international ... WebFeb 24, 2024 · A Hamiltonian cycle (or Hamiltonian circuit) is a Hamiltonian Path such that there is an edge (in the graph) from the last vertex to the first vertex of the Hamiltonian …
WebOct 18, 2011 · Take 2 pointer *p and *q , start traversing the linked list "LL" using both pointers : 1) pointer p will delete previous node each time and pointing to next node. 2) pointer q will go each time in forward direction direction only. 1) pointer p is pointing to null and q is pointing to some node : Loop is present. WebFeb 19, 2024 · Therefore, after detecting the cycle using the slow and the fast pointers, we can move one of the pointers back to the head of the linked list and move both pointers one step at a time until they meet again. The meeting point is the start of the cycle. Complexity Time complexity: O (n) Space complexity: O (1) Code
WebComplexity Analysis Time Complexity. O(N) where n is the number of inserted nodes in the given list. Since we have used HashSet or unordered_set which ensures insertion and searching in O(1) which allowed us to achieve linear time complexity. Space Complexity. O(N) because we used a HashSet wherein the worst case we’ll have to insert N nodes.
WebOct 12, 2010 · It then outlines the proposed complexity model's 11 dimensions in relation to three levels of project complexity and details the process of applying the model--via an approach based on complexity thinking--to manage various types of project situations, such as selecting a project cycle and management techniques that are most appropriate to ... fotos catálogoWebWe let Ck stand for a simple cycle of length k. When considering directed graphs, a Ck is assumed to be directed. We show that a Ck in a directed or undirected graph G = (V, E), … fotos csaWebJan 15, 2024 · A Eulerian cycle is a Eulerian path that is a cycle. The problem is to find the Eulerian path in an undirected multigraph with loops. Algorithm. First we can check if there is an Eulerian path. We can use the following theorem. ... The complexity of this algorithm is obviously linear with respect to the number of edges. fotos csgoWebThen, let's compute. dist [i] = the shortest distance from node S to node i. par [i] = the parent of node i; any node j where dist [i] = dist [j] + 1. in O (V + E) time using a simple BFS. Now, the key idea is to find, for each edge, the shortest cycle from S … fotos csiWebMar 6, 2024 · Asymptotic time complexity describes the upper bound for how the algorithm behaves as n tends to infinity. The connection between this and measuring the actual (not worst-case) performance for n=2 on a modern CPU in a compiled language with an optimizer is extremely weak. fotos casa batlló gaudíWebMar 24, 2024 · Finally, the call will return the length of the shortest cycle in the given graph . 3.3. Complexity The time complexity of this approach is , where is the number of vertices of the given graph , and is the number of edges. The reason behind this complexity is that we’re visiting each vertex at most twice, and each edge at most once. fotos cv ball 2023WebMenghitung Cyclomatic complexity dari Edge dan Node Dengan Rumus : V G = E – N + 2 Dimana : E jumlah edge pada flowgraph = 10 N jumlah node pada flowgraph = 10 Penyelesaian : V G 10 – 10 + 2 V G = 2 Jadi jumlah path dari flowgraph di atas sebanyak 2 … fotos da anya fofa